Job Duties

  • Oversee day-to-day dining room and service floor operations to ensure timely, clean, and high-quality service
  • Serve as the shift lead during assigned service periods monitoring food flow, managing line setup, and resolving service-related issues in real time
  • Conduct weekly inventory counts and monitor stock levels to ensure essential items are available for service
  • Ensure all staff follow local, state, and UHD safety and sanitation policies reinforcing best practices in food handling and cleanliness
  • Supervise full-time, part-time, and student staff working during assigned shifts fostering a respectful and collaborative team culture focused on safety, service, and accountability
  • Deliver hands-on coaching and real-time feedback to support staff performance
  • Participate and support recruitment efforts for dining staff in collaboration with UHD HR
  • Assist with onboarding and training new team members, monitor daily attendance, and help ensure staff are prepared for each shift
  • Conduct performance reviews, track training progress, and support staff development
  • Set clear expectations for conduct, service, and safety, and model the standards expected from all team members
  • Address performance concerns promptly and professionally issuing corrective actions when necessary in alignment with UHD HR policies
  • Champion a customer-first approach by ensuring staff deliver friendly and efficient service
  • Be present and engaged on the floor during service periods to interact with guests, resolve concerns, and support a welcoming dining environment
  • Communicate guest feedback to management and assist in implementing service improvements
  • Support themed events and special meal promotions to enhance the student dining experience
  • Support clear and consistent communication across shifts by documenting shift updates, issues, and key action items
  • Share information with team members and managers to maintain alignment across service periods
  • Represent UHD values through respectful communication and teamwork with staff, students, and guests
